Adventure Tips

Book Cavern Tours in Advance

Pech Merle Cavern limits daily visitors to protect fragile art; reserving ahead is essential.

Wear Comfortable Walking Shoes

Expect uneven surfaces inside the cavern and cobblestone paths in St Cirq-LaPopie.

Pack a Light Jacket

The cavern maintains a cool temperature year-round, so layers help maintain comfort.

Carry Water and Snacks

Limited food options on site; bring water and light snacks for the day.

History

Pech Merle’s cave paintings are among the few worldwide where original prehistoric art remains visible to the public, dating back around 25,000 years.

Conservation

Strict visitor limits and guided tours protect the delicate cave environment and prehistoric art from damage while promoting sustainable tourism in the region.
